Maslenitsa is welcomed on Monday (this calendar year February twentieth) which has a sculpting of an effigy of Winter season. Dressed in Girls’s garments, the figure will ultimately be burned to symbolize the changeover from winter to spring.
The effigy is generally set in the middle of a big open up Place and is also surrounded by people that do khorovod. Khorovod is a mix of a circle dance and chorus singing. Then the effigy is burnt, This is often how men and women say goodbye to winterand welcome spring.
Singing and dancing even have Particular meanings. Cheerful songs and songs should catch the attention of spring and convey an excellent temper. Men and women are welcoming spring and hope which the spring will hear their phone calls.
It’s also a day to bid farewell Maslenitsa to winter by using a ritual burning of the effigy Create before within the 7 days. Throwing remnants of blinis in the burning lady symbolized the spiritual preparing for Lent.
Maslenitsa 7 days celebrations acquire from equally Pagan and Christian traditions. Based on the Christian Orthodoxy, the usage of meat is already forbidden by Shrovetide 7 days; eggs and dairy, having said that, are usually not. As a result, crepe week makes use of the last 7 days they might eat the ingredients which make up the holiday’s delicacies.

The traditions in the celebration of Maslenitsa are usually not forgotten nowadays, Even though the celebration mostly normally takes put only on the last day of Maslenitsa – Sunday.
At Maslenitsa pancakes are cooked in pretty massive portions to be used in virtually every ritual, These are offered to relatives and buddies all throughout the week.
Local artisans present their artwork on the road and merriment ensues within the streets of small Russian cities.
